[PATCH] D24373: [Coroutines] Adding builtins for coroutine intrinsics and backendutil support.
Gor Nishanov via cfe-commits
cfe-commits at lists.llvm.org
Thu Sep 8 21:35:55 PDT 2016
GorNishanov created this revision.
GorNishanov added reviewers: rsmith, majnemer.
GorNishanov added a subscriber: cfe-commits.
Herald added subscribers: beanz, mehdi_amini.
With this commit simple coroutines can be created in plain C using coroutine builtins (see coro.c and coro.h for an example):
https://reviews.llvm.org/D24373
Files:
include/clang/Basic/Builtins.def
lib/CodeGen/BackendUtil.cpp
lib/CodeGen/CGBuiltin.cpp
lib/CodeGen/CMakeLists.txt
test/Coroutines/Inputs/coro.h
test/Coroutines/coro.c
-------------- next part --------------
A non-text attachment was scrubbed...
Name: D24373.70780.patch
Type: text/x-patch
Size: 8135 bytes
Desc: not available
URL: <http://lists.llvm.org/pipermail/cfe-commits/attachments/20160909/4f8ba928/attachment-0001.bin>
More information about the cfe-commits
mailing list